Despite the various challenges they have encountered in managing the 2016 elections, Commission on Elections (Comelec) Chair Andres Bautista believes they have outperformed their expectation.

“I always try to have positive attitude towards everything. But I’d like to think that we outperformed our expectation,” he told reporters when asked if he was satisfied with the outcome of the recent polls.

According to Bautista, they intend to review and assess the poll body’s performance in a bid to improve future electoral exercises.

“We will probably call for something like a strategic planning conference of various Comelec officials so that we can assess what we did well and what we can improve so that for the next elections, we build upon the gains of this elections,” he said.

“We want to come up with a draft omnibus election code that will be more reflective of the current situation especially when it comes to technology—how technology has changed our election,” Bautista added.
